#f18260 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#f18260 is composed of 94.5% red, 51% green and 37.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 46.1% magenta, 60.2% yellow and 5.5% black. It has a hue angle of 14.1 degrees, a saturation of 83.8% and a lightness of 66.1%. #f18260 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ffc0 with #e30500. Closest websafe color is: #ff9966.

#f18260 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#f18260 has RGB values of R:241, G:130, B:96 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.46, Y:0.6, K:0.05. Its decimal value is 15827552.
